Black, white and red polka dot wedding

Aug 19, 2009 | Colour

Black and white polka dots with red - primadonnabride.co.za

Polka dots are so playful and fun for a wedding. Love the addition of the red to the normal black and white.  You could do so much with a roll or two of polka dotted ribbon. Wrap around invitations and  favour boxes to pretty them up. You could also add ribbons to your bouquet to complete the look.
